Notably, Hyderabad's Shamshabad Airport has become a hotspot for gold and valuable smuggling, with customs officers regularly intercepting such attempts.

The latest incident involved a creative yet unlawful approach to smuggling - a golden saree. Recent events have revealed that customs authorities are making strides in apprehending gold smugglers at Shamshabad. These smugglers, however, have been employing ingenious methods to bypass security measures. The recent discovery exposed a substantial amount of illicit gold at the airport. A passenger arriving from Dubai was found to be carrying 416 grams of gold, valued at approximately Rs 28 lakh.

The traveler had ingeniously sprayed gold onto a saree, concealed it within a box, and attempted to pass through security unnoticed. Prompted by the passenger's suspicious behavior, customs officials detained and subsequently examined the saree, revealing the intricate gold spray. The total weight of the gold-infused saree was determined to be around 416 grams. The individual is currently in custody and undergoing interrogation by customs officials. This incident is merely one among several such cases unfolding at Shamshabad Airport.
